Key points include: The 2nd India-CARICOM Summit was held in Georgetown, Guyana, co-chaired by PM of India and PM of Grenada (CARICOM Chair).. The first summit took place in 2019 in New York, establishing high-level dialogue.. CARICOM is a 15-member regional bloc focused on economic integration and cooperation..
